Ethiopian Airlines to launch Addis Ababa–Port Harcourt service in December
Ethiopian Airlines will begin flying between Addis Ababa and Port Harcourt in Nigeria on 1 December, operating four times a week with a Boeing 737 Max 8.

Ethiopian Airlines will begin serving Port Harcourt on 1 December, linking the Nigerian city with its Addis Ababa hub. Four weekly flights are planned: Mondays, Tuesdays, Thursdays and Saturdays.
The route will be flown with a Boeing 737 Max 8. From Addis Ababa the flight departs at 9:30 and arrives in Port Harcourt at 12:25. The return leg leaves at 13:10, reaching Addis Ababa at 20:30.
Port Harcourt is Ethiopian Airlines' fifth destination in Nigeria. The airline said passengers on the new service can connect through the Addis Ababa hub to the rest of its international network.
